Iran turns to interim leadership while Ali Larijani accuses Israel of seeking to ‘partition’ nation

In the wake of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ei's assassination, Iran is set to form a temporary leadership council to navigate the transition of power amidst rising regional tensions. Ali Larijani, a prominent Iranian politician, has expressed concerns that Israel aims to exploit the situation to fragment Iran. As Tehran prepares for succession procedures, the political landscape remains precarious, with internal and external pressures mounting. The establishment of a provisional leadership is seen as a crucial step to maintain stability and continuity in governance during this tumultuous period. Analysts suggest that the developments could significantly impact Iran’s domestic policy and its relations with neighboring countries, particularly amid ongoing geopolitical rivalries. The call for unity against perceived external threats highlights the urgency for a coherent leadership strategy as Iran grapples with both political and security challenges in the region.
